ROG Cetra Open Wireless Gaming Earbuds arrive with RGB lighting

Asus, the gaming hardware giant, has kicked off the global launch of its latest wireless earbuds, the ROG Cetra Open Wireless, making their way to markets like the United States and Europe.

This new model is making waves in the expanding open-ear audio scene by blending gaming-centric features such as RGB lighting and low-latency wireless connectivity.

These earbuds were initially unveiled earlier this year at CES 2026 in Las Vegas, and now they’re officially up for grabs worldwide.

Gaming design meets open-ear comfort

Unlike traditional in-ear earbuds, the ROG Cetra Open Wireless uses an open-ear design that sits outside the ear canal. This approach is intended to provide a more comfortable listening experience while still allowing users to stay aware of their surroundings.

Staying true to the Republic of Gamers aesthetic, Asus has added customizable Aura RGB lighting. The earbuds support four preset lighting effects and allow users to choose from up to 16.8 million colours, giving them a distinctly gaming-inspired look rarely seen in open-ear audio devices.

The earbuds are currently available in a single black colour option.

Low-latency wireless for gaming

One feature that separates the ROG Cetra Open Wireless from many open-ear competitors is support for 2.4 GHz wireless audio. This technology helps reduce latency, making the earbuds suitable for gaming and media where audio delay can be noticeable.

With 2.4 GHz connectivity, the earbuds can work with devices such as the PlayStation 4 and PlayStation 5. At launch, however, mobile devices connect using Bluetooth 6.0 on Android and iOS.

Asus says support for 2.4 GHz audio on Android will arrive later through a software update.

Key features and specifications

The earbuds include 14 mm drivers with a 16-ohm impedance and a frequency response ranging from 20 Hz to 20 kHz. Asus also provides sound customization through EQ controls in its Gear Link companion app.

Other notable features include:

  • IPX5 water resistance for protection against sweat and light rain
  • A detachable reflective neck strap designed for runners
  • Multiple sound modes including Phantom Bass and Immersion Mode

Battery life is rated at up to 16 hours, although this figure is achieved with RGB lighting, microphone use, and enhanced audio modes turned off.

Price and availability

Asus is selling the ROG Cetra Open Wireless in several regions at the following prices:

  • $229.99 in the United States
  • €219 across the Eurozone
  • £184.99 in the United Kingdom

With its blend of open-ear comfort, gaming aesthetics and low-latency connectivity, the ROG Cetra Open Wireless aims to carve out a niche among gamers and active users who want something different from traditional wireless earbuds.
